Enterprise IT can often be complex and overwhelming, with a plethora of systems, tools, and processes that need to be managed and maintained. Simplifying enterprise IT can help organizations to improve efficiency, reduce costs, and increase productivity. Here are 4 strategies that can be used to simplify enterprise IT:

First, consolidate and standardize your systems and tools. This means using fewer, but more robust and versatile, tools and platforms to handle a variety of tasks. Rather than using a different tool for project management, customer relationship management, and task tracking, consider using a single, integrated platform that can handle all these tasks. By standardizing on a single platform or technology stack, organizations not only reduce the number of systems they need to manage, but also make it easier for their team to access and use the tools they need.

Second, another way to simplify enterprise IT is to automate as many processes as possible. This can help reduce the need for manual intervention, freeing up your team to focus on more important tasks. Automation can also help reduce errors and improve the accuracy and consistency of your processes. For example, you can use automation to automatically generate reports, send emails, or update customer records.

The third way to simplify enterprise IT is to adopt a cloud-based approach. This means moving your systems and data to the cloud, allowing your team to access them from anywhere, at any time, and on any device. This not only makes your systems more flexible and scalable, but also makes it easier for your team to collaborate and share information and reduces the need for on-premises infrastructure.

Finally, it’s important to regularly review and assess your enterprise IT systems and processes and implement a robust security strategy. This can help identify any inefficiencies or areas for improvement, and allow you to make changes that will simplify and streamline your enterprise IT. Furthermore, a comprehensive security strategy can help to protect against threats and ensure that sensitive data is secure.

Overall, simplifying your enterprise IT can help make your systems more efficient and effective, and allow your team to focus on the tasks that really matter. By consolidating and standardizing your systems, automating processes, adopting a cloud-based approach, and regularly reviewing and assessing your enterprise IT, you can create a more streamlined and effective IT environment.
